Transaction 30cf70e7660a3fcf11bb3e83bac29f4c603887b4350db0ed5d9f45e105fae1d6
1 Input
1 Output
-
30cf70e7660a3fcf11bb3e83bac29f4c603887b4350db0ed5d9f45e105fae1d6:0
- value
- 13998171
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ec6ebac6164bb1f035427ce4d21600247fd02eb
- address
- bc1qdmrwhtrpvja37q65yl8y6gtqqfrl6qhtvwzs9c